Tasting Notes: Orange Marmalade, Chocolate

Process: Washed

Cooperative: SOPACDI

Region: Kivu

Elevation: 1600-1800 masl

Variety: Bourbon, Caturra, Catuai

Importer: Cafe Imports

This coffee is from SOPACDI, a cooperative of farmers scattered throughout the highlands surrounding Lake Kivu, a richly diverse area in terms of elevation, flora, and climate. The high elevations of the Virunga mountains are temperate, rainy, and volcanic creating an ideal climate for coffee production.

SOPACDI was created to enable local producers to unite together and commercialize their coffee for direct collective international export instead of having to transport the coffee themselves overseas on a dangerous journey. Before SOPACDI was founded, farmers had to smuggle coffee across Lake Kivu to Rwanda to barter for food and goods. This sometimes resulted in people losing their lives when attempting to cross the lake in bad weather. Thankfully, SOPACDI’s creation means coffee producers can now safely cultivate high quality coffee together to export internationally.

This is a light roast lover's medium roast. Or a medium roast lover's light roast. It's got some really awesome jammy orange notes on the front end that reminds us of a washed Ethiopian coffee but with a little bit more chocolate in the cup that keeps the acidity from being too overpowering.
